OpenAI Seeks U.S. Loan Guarantees for $1 Trillion AI Expansion
OpenAI is actively pursuing federal loan guarantees as part of a transformative strategy to finance its extensive artificial intelligence (AI) expansion, which could exceed $1 trillion. This move marks a significant shift for a Silicon Valley technology firm, traditionally distanced from government support.
Seeking U.S. Support for AI Expansion
During a recent Wall Street Journal business conference, OpenAI’s Chief Financial Officer, Sarah Friar, discussed the company’s ambitious plans. She elaborated on the potential benefits that federal backing could offer, emphasizing the capacity to attract a broader spectrum of funding sources.
Impact of Government Backing
Federal loan guarantees could significantly reduce borrowing costs for OpenAI. This financial strategy would enhance the company’s access to credit markets while providing protection to lenders against potential losses in the event of a default. Friar’s proposal aligns OpenAI with sectors like energy and infrastructure that have historically relied on government support.
Capital-Intensive Commitments
OpenAI’s financing request comes amid substantial commitments in the tech industry. Notably, the company has announced preliminary agreements involving:
- $300 billion deal with Oracle
- $500 billion ‘Stargate’ data center venture in partnership with Oracle and SoftBank
Despite these high-profile engagements, OpenAI’s revenue projections for this year remain in the tens of billions. The disparity between this income and the vast investments needed for sustaining AI operations raises concerns about financial viability.
Future Plans and IPO Speculation
Friar addressed rumors regarding an initial public offering (IPO), asserting that it is “not on the cards right now.” Instead, she reaffirmed that the company’s primary focus lies in scaling its operations and securing essential financing for its long-term goals.
